Local press started sharing the draft of the cannabis law, supposedly composed by different documents: One regarding hemp regulation and another one about the medical cannabis license prices, etc. Instead, however, we find one document, an incomplete description of what will be the growing process, as well as processing and selling hemp with industrial, food and medical purposes, all containing no more than 1% THC.
We've collected the headline evolution from last Wednesday, starting at 1:52 pm and towards 4:54 pm, where they began with "Hemp and medical cannabis industry will start on September 9th with the bill signature". And ended with talking only about industrial hemp:

What is going to happen with the medical cannabis law? It would be ready in 8 months, as the ex-congress lady who created the second cannabis bill said:
Update: After speculation about the absence of guidelines to regulate the medicinal purposes of the importation and production of cannabis with high percentages of its psychotropic compound (THC), this week was announced that it is in public consultation: Draft regulations - Law No. 10113.
